  • Title

    An accurate GTO model for circuit simulations

  • Abstract
    The GTO model presented in this paper uses analytical expressions to describe the internal physics of the device. It has been implemented to run as compiled code in the SPICE simulation package and as a MAST template in the Saber simulator. A rigorous comparison of measured simulated waveforms and performance parameters (including turn-off energies) for a 3000 A device is described and discussed
